三維數(shù)字人像與虛擬場(chǎng)景的合成系統(tǒng)的制作方法
【技術(shù)領(lǐng)域】
[0001] 本發(fā)明屬于一般的圖像數(shù)據(jù)處理領(lǐng)域,設(shè)及=維數(shù)字人像與虛擬場(chǎng)景的合成系 統(tǒng)。
【背景技術(shù)】
[0002] 人物和場(chǎng)景的合成,是一種典型的攝影技法。它可W不受地點(diǎn)、時(shí)間、季節(jié)、條件 的限制,可W讓用戶通過(guò)簡(jiǎn)單編輯,將人像置于預(yù)設(shè)的優(yōu)美場(chǎng)景之中,使人像和場(chǎng)景有機(jī)結(jié) 合,合成出新的、W假亂真的美麗畫面,進(jìn)一步滿足用戶方便完成內(nèi)容創(chuàng)造的需求。
[0003] 本發(fā)明將提出=維數(shù)字人像與虛擬場(chǎng)景的合成系統(tǒng)。=維數(shù)字人像是指已經(jīng)建好 的=維數(shù)字人像模型,它是具有照片真實(shí)感的=維幾何模型,不但逼真地再現(xiàn)了用戶的形 狀,還有特定的姿態(tài)。虛擬場(chǎng)景是指計(jì)算機(jī)通過(guò)數(shù)字技術(shù)建立的數(shù)字化場(chǎng)景,該場(chǎng)景中,其 來(lái)源包括預(yù)先制作好的二維圖像和=維立體場(chǎng)景、甚至是即時(shí)抓拍的數(shù)字照片。
[0004] 根據(jù)檢索,與本發(fā)明相關(guān)的有專利有CN201310530450和CN200810302744。1)專利 CN201310530450為基于旋轉(zhuǎn)攝像頭拍攝的人景圖像合成方法和系統(tǒng),它將同一個(gè)攝像頭旋 轉(zhuǎn)拍攝的人物和景物圖像合成在一起。2)專利CN200810302744為一種圖像合成系統(tǒng),它從 前景圖像中提取出前景物體,并將之與背景圖像合成在一起,合成后圖像的色彩具有一致 度。與之相比,本發(fā)明合成的對(duì)象是=維數(shù)字人像和虛擬場(chǎng)景,不再是二維圖像。
[0005] 簡(jiǎn)而言之,本發(fā)明的特征在于=維數(shù)字人像和虛擬場(chǎng)景的合成,=維數(shù)字人像與 虛擬場(chǎng)景間提供了靈活的合成機(jī)制,用戶進(jìn)而將結(jié)果共享給朋友。
【發(fā)明內(nèi)容】
[0006] 為了滿足用戶進(jìn)行內(nèi)容生成的需要,本發(fā)明提出一種=維數(shù)字人像和虛擬場(chǎng)景的 合成系統(tǒng),該系統(tǒng)可W生成更具娛樂(lè)性的人像和場(chǎng)景合影。將=維數(shù)字人像置于預(yù)設(shè)的虛 擬場(chǎng)景中,使人像和場(chǎng)景有機(jī)結(jié)合,包括人人合成、人景合成。
[0007] 該合成系統(tǒng),其組成包括四部分;=維數(shù)字人像模塊、虛擬場(chǎng)景模塊、合成模塊、共 享輸出模塊。=維數(shù)字人像模塊和虛擬場(chǎng)景模塊是合成模塊的輸入,合成模塊的結(jié)果傳遞 給共享輸出模塊。
[000引 1)=維數(shù)字人像模塊 =維數(shù)字人像模塊提供個(gè)性化的=維數(shù)字人像模型M的建模功能。個(gè)性化建模是指在 計(jì)算機(jī)中創(chuàng)建人像的=維幾何模型,重建出的模型不僅具有個(gè)體的形狀特性,而且具有個(gè) 體特定的姿態(tài)特性,具有顯著的個(gè)性化特征,達(dá)到照片真實(shí)感的逼真度,能夠識(shí)別出個(gè)體的 身份。
[0009] 當(dāng)前,可W采用的建模方法有多種,例如,=維人體掃描儀、基于高清圖像的人像 自動(dòng)建模系統(tǒng)、職業(yè)美工使用的=維數(shù)字人像專業(yè)建模軟件。盡管建模方法有很大的不同, 建立的=維數(shù)字人像模型的結(jié)果是可W統(tǒng)一的。
[0010] 為了便于=維數(shù)字人像與虛擬場(chǎng)景的合成,本發(fā)明將=維數(shù)字人像M統(tǒng)一表示為 帶紋理的=角網(wǎng)格模型。在模型中,=維網(wǎng)格表示了=維數(shù)字人像的幾何外形,紋理則是在 =維數(shù)字人像的表面上繪制色彩c"的圖案。紋理貼圖是在=維模型著色方面最引人注意、 也是最擬真的方法,它將平面圖像直接貼到=維網(wǎng)格上。從而,在保持需要較小存儲(chǔ)空間的 前提下,=維數(shù)字人像M具有高逼真度,具有照片真實(shí)感。
[0011] 2)虛擬場(chǎng)景模塊 該模塊提供畫面優(yōu)美的虛擬場(chǎng)景,該場(chǎng)景為在一定的時(shí)間、空間內(nèi)發(fā)生的一定的任務(wù) 行動(dòng)或因人物關(guān)系所構(gòu)成的具體畫面,并通過(guò)計(jì)算機(jī),W數(shù)字化的方式表現(xiàn)出來(lái)。場(chǎng)景的主 題不但可W是風(fēng)景,也可W是人物場(chǎng)景。該虛擬場(chǎng)景的素材來(lái)源多樣,可W是預(yù)先制作好的 二維圖像和S維立體場(chǎng)景、甚至是即時(shí)抓拍的數(shù)字照片。
[0012] 為了方便與=維人像的合成,虛擬場(chǎng)景也表示為=維坐標(biāo)形式。對(duì)于二維圖像和 數(shù)字照片,通過(guò)場(chǎng)景分割算法,自動(dòng)標(biāo)識(shí)出地面范圍,作為=維數(shù)字人像底部的活動(dòng)空間。 對(duì)于=維場(chǎng)景,也標(biāo)識(shí)出=維數(shù)字人像在場(chǎng)景中的活動(dòng)空間。簡(jiǎn)而言之,就是將虛擬場(chǎng)景S 表示為=維形式,進(jìn)而將其分割,標(biāo)識(shí)出=維數(shù)字人像的活動(dòng)區(qū)域S。。
[0013] 簡(jiǎn)而言之,虛擬場(chǎng)景S為劃分出活動(dòng)區(qū)域S。的S維場(chǎng)景。與S維數(shù)字人像相同, 該場(chǎng)景也統(tǒng)一表示為帶紋理的=角網(wǎng)格模型。從而,通過(guò)相同的表示方法,本發(fā)明統(tǒng)一了= 維數(shù)字人像和虛擬場(chǎng)景的表示,為后繼的合成奠定了操作的基礎(chǔ)。
[0014] 3)合成模塊 該模塊向用戶提供合成的編輯工具,方便用戶生成理想的合成結(jié)果。該編輯操作是在 =維空間內(nèi)完成的。首先,=維數(shù)字人像M的位置被限制在虛擬場(chǎng)景所設(shè)定的活動(dòng)空間S。 中,并與之有機(jī)地結(jié)合在一起;然后,用戶在該活動(dòng)空間中,通過(guò)拖放=維數(shù)字人像,更改= 維數(shù)字人像的位置,并通過(guò)旋轉(zhuǎn)和縮放功能,完成=維數(shù)字人像模型的編輯;最后,根據(jù)虛 擬場(chǎng)景的色彩效果,自動(dòng)調(diào)整=維數(shù)字人像的色彩,將=維數(shù)字人像模型和虛擬場(chǎng)景自然 地合成在一起。
[0015] 具體而言,在虛擬場(chǎng)景S的活動(dòng)區(qū)域Se內(nèi),=維數(shù)字人像模型M與虛擬場(chǎng)景S合 理地合成在一起,形成一個(gè)和諧的=維畫面。
[0016] 在合成過(guò)程中,本發(fā)明使用了泊松合成機(jī)制,W虛擬場(chǎng)景中與=維數(shù)字人像相鄰 區(qū)域Q的色彩C S作為邊界約束,調(diào)節(jié)S維數(shù)字人像的色彩C M,生成S維數(shù)字人像的最終色 彩C。該泊松合成機(jī)制可公式化表示為:
【主權(quán)項(xiàng)】
1. 三維數(shù)字人像與虛擬場(chǎng)景的合成系統(tǒng),將三維數(shù)字人像置于預(yù)設(shè)的虛擬場(chǎng)景中,使 人像和場(chǎng)景有機(jī)結(jié)合,包括人景合成、人人合成,其特征在于,系統(tǒng)包括四個(gè)組成模塊:三維 數(shù)字人像模塊、虛擬場(chǎng)景模塊、合成模塊、共享輸出模塊,三維數(shù)字人像模塊和虛擬場(chǎng)景模 塊是合成模塊的輸入,合成模塊的結(jié)果傳遞給共享輸出模塊; 所述三維數(shù)字人像模塊提供個(gè)性化的三維數(shù)字人像模型M,個(gè)性化的三維數(shù)字人像模 型M建模是指在計(jì)算機(jī)中創(chuàng)建人像的三維幾何模型,該模型不僅具有個(gè)體的形狀特性,而 且具有個(gè)體特定的姿態(tài)特性,達(dá)到照片的逼真度,能夠識(shí)別出個(gè)體的身份,建模方法有:三 維人體掃描儀、基于高清圖像的人像自動(dòng)建模系統(tǒng)、三維數(shù)字人像專業(yè)建模軟件; 所述虛擬場(chǎng)景模塊提供虛擬場(chǎng)景,以數(shù)字化的方式表現(xiàn)出來(lái),虛擬場(chǎng)景表示為三維坐 標(biāo)形式,對(duì)于二維圖像和數(shù)字照片,通過(guò)場(chǎng)景分割算法,自動(dòng)標(biāo)識(shí)出地面范圍,作為三維數(shù) 字人像底部的活動(dòng)空間;對(duì)于三維場(chǎng)景,標(biāo)識(shí)出三維數(shù)字人像在場(chǎng)景中的活動(dòng)空間,將虛擬 場(chǎng)景S表示為三維形式,進(jìn)而將其分割,標(biāo)識(shí)出三維數(shù)字人像的活動(dòng)區(qū)域S e; 所述合成模塊向用戶提供合成的編輯工具,方便用戶生成合成結(jié)果,該編輯操作是在 三維空間內(nèi)完成,首先,三維數(shù)字人像模型M的位置被限制在虛擬場(chǎng)景所設(shè)定的活動(dòng)空間Se 中,然后,用戶在該活動(dòng)空間中,完成三維數(shù)字人像模型的編輯;最后,根據(jù)虛擬場(chǎng)景的色彩 效果,自動(dòng)調(diào)整三維數(shù)字人像的色彩,將三維數(shù)字人像模型和虛擬場(chǎng)景合成在一起; 所述共享輸出模塊提供二維和三維兩種輸出功能,結(jié)果在用戶間共享,在二維方面,提 供渲染功能,輸出合成結(jié)果的二維圖像文件;在三維方面,則提供整個(gè)三維數(shù)字人像和虛擬 場(chǎng)景合成結(jié)果的三維場(chǎng)景文件。
2. 根據(jù)權(quán)利要求1所述的三維數(shù)字人像與虛擬場(chǎng)景的合成系統(tǒng),其特征在于,所述合 成過(guò)程,使用泊松合成機(jī)制,以虛擬場(chǎng)景中與三維數(shù)字人像相鄰區(qū)域Ω的色彩C 3作為邊界 約束,調(diào)節(jié)三維數(shù)字人像的色彩CM,生成三維數(shù)字人像的最終色彩C,該泊松合成機(jī)制公式 化表示為:
其中,7為梯度算子,s. t代表約束,Cjm=QIm說(shuō)明:合成后的三維數(shù)字人像,其在邊 界Ω處的色彩,與虛擬場(chǎng)景在該邊界處的色彩C s相等; 根據(jù)歐拉-拉格朗日方程,上面的變分方程有最優(yōu)解時(shí),當(dāng)且僅當(dāng):
其中,AC= dn<VCM)為拉普拉斯算子,即Cwr在區(qū)域Ω上,先求梯度(▽),再求散度 (div),從而,將求解變換成帶約束的線性方程組最小二乘求解。
3. 根據(jù)權(quán)利要求1所述的三維數(shù)字人像與虛擬場(chǎng)景的合成系統(tǒng),其特征在于,所述人 景合成具體過(guò)程包括:1)使用三維掃描儀建立三維數(shù)字人像:使用三維掃描儀掃描用戶, 通過(guò)三維表面重建,建立個(gè)性化的三維數(shù)字人像,該人像具有照片真實(shí)感;2)使用預(yù)定好的 風(fēng)景圖像建立虛擬場(chǎng)景:通過(guò)著名的風(fēng)景圖像,建立圖像庫(kù),并對(duì)庫(kù)中的每幅圖像,標(biāo)識(shí)出 三維數(shù)字人像的底部活動(dòng)空間,在三維坐標(biāo)系中,建立虛擬場(chǎng)景;3 )三維數(shù)字人像與風(fēng)景場(chǎng) 景的合成:在虛擬場(chǎng)景中,用戶編輯三維數(shù)字人像,合成出預(yù)期的人景合成效果;4)輸出人 景合成圖片:通過(guò)渲染,建立三維數(shù)字人像和風(fēng)景場(chǎng)景的合成圖片,并可通過(guò)圖片文件,共 享給用戶的朋友。
4.根據(jù)權(quán)利要求1所述的三維數(shù)字人像與虛擬場(chǎng)景的合成系統(tǒng),其特征在于,所述人 人合成具體過(guò)程包括:1)使用多幅高清圖像建立三維數(shù)字人像:使用用戶多幅高清圖像, 通過(guò)計(jì)算機(jī)視覺(jué)的圖像建模方法,建立高逼真度的三維數(shù)字人像模型;2)使用三維掃描儀 建立虛擬人物場(chǎng)景:通過(guò)對(duì)著名人物雕塑的掃描,建立虛擬人物場(chǎng)景,并在場(chǎng)景中建立三維 數(shù)字人像的活動(dòng)空間;3)三維數(shù)字人像與虛擬人物場(chǎng)景的合成:在虛擬人物場(chǎng)景中,合成 出預(yù)期的人人合成效果;4)輸出人人合成文件:將三維數(shù)字人像和人物場(chǎng)景的合成結(jié)果, 存儲(chǔ)為三維場(chǎng)景文件,共享給用戶的朋友。
【專利摘要】本發(fā)明涉及三維數(shù)字人像與虛擬場(chǎng)景的合成系統(tǒng)。該系統(tǒng)包括四個(gè)組成模塊:三維數(shù)字人像模塊、虛擬場(chǎng)景模塊、合成模塊、共享輸出模塊,三維數(shù)字人像模塊和虛擬場(chǎng)景模塊是合成模塊的輸入,合成模塊的結(jié)果傳遞給共享輸出模塊。該系統(tǒng)通過(guò)編輯三維數(shù)字人像和虛擬場(chǎng)景的合成方式,生成更具娛樂(lè)性的人像和場(chǎng)景合影,合成出新的、以假亂真的美麗畫面,滿足用戶進(jìn)行內(nèi)容創(chuàng)造的需要。
【IPC分類】G06T17-00
【公開(kāi)號(hào)】CN104537716
【申請(qǐng)?zhí)枴緾N201510027347
【發(fā)明人】程志全, 徐華勛
【申請(qǐng)人】湖南化身科技有限公司
【公開(kāi)日】2015年4月22日
【申請(qǐng)日】2015年1月20日